pile·
인프라 / DevOps·cloudflare-blogCloudflare Blog·

코어 유닛 부팅 시간을 몇 시간에서 몇 분으로 줄인 방법

문제펌웨어 업데이트 이후 Gen12 서버 약 2,000대의 부팅 시간이 4시간으로 늘어 유지보수와 신규 서버 투입을 심각하게 지연시켰다.
접근iPXE 사전 부팅 단계에서 UEFI 네트워크 부팅 인터페이스 우선순위를 명시적으로 선언해 불필요한 타임아웃 순서를 제거했다. 벤더 BIOS 잠금 해제, EFI_IFR_REF3 데이터 구조 처리, NIC 명명 규칙 차이 극복 세 가지 기술 장애물을 순차 해결했다.
결과펌웨어 업그레이드 자동화는 4시간 → 3분, 단건 부팅은 20분 → 1분 미만으로 단축됐다. 모든 하드웨어 SKU에 단일 펌웨어 이미지로 대응 가능해졌다.
cloudflare-blog
Cloudflare Blog 블로그
원문은 여기서 이어서 읽을 수 있어요
원문 읽기
읽음 (0)

이 글과 비슷한

  1. 인프라 / DevOps·vercel-blogVercel Blog·

    Vercel CLI 드라이런 배포로 실제 배포 전 구성 미리 확인하기

    Vercel CLI v54.17.2부터 vercel deploy --dry 명령으로 실제 파일 업로드 없이 배포 구성을 미리 검사할 수 있다. 프레임워크 감지 결과, 포함/제외 파일 목록, 디렉터리 크기 분포, 콘텐츠 해시까지 사전에 확인하고 나서 배포를 결정할 수 있어 의도치 않은 배포 실패를 예방한다.

    #deployment#ci-cd#vercel-cli+1